Nextern Maple Grove, MN site seeks a Quality Assurance/Manufacturing Compliance professional to ensure production and process control compliance during the development and manufacturing of medical devices. This role will involve direct monitoring and training of production staff to uphold quality standards.
You will perform Device History Record (DHR) reviews, make decisions on product acceptability with operators, and identify procedures that guarantee quality production.
This position is responsible for ensuring production and process control compliance during the development and manufacturing of medical devices at the Nextern Maple Grove facility. This position may also involve quality assurance of product conformance for dimensional, electrical, and visual workmanship standards in accordance with requirements.
This job has no supervisory responsibilities.
